6. Geopolitical Context and Regional Security Concerns
The joint exercise occurs against a backdrop of heightened regional tensions. Iran’s adversaries—particularly Saudi Arabia and Israel—view these developments with concern, fearing escalation and further militarization of the Persian Gulf.
Russia’s involvement signals a strategic pivot towards a multipolar security architecture, reducing reliance on Western military alliances. Moscow’s support enhances Iran’s regional resilience and challenges U.S. dominance.
The exercises are also seen as a response to ongoing sanctions, increased U.S. military presence, and regional conflicts, including the Yemen civil war and tensions with Israel and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) states.
